Paint.net - Paint.net - Wikipedia
![]() | |
![]() paint.net verze 4.1.5 | |
Původní autoři | Rick Brewster |
---|---|
Vývojáři | dotPDN, LLC |
První vydání | 6. května 2004 |
Stabilní uvolnění | 4.2.14 / 23. října 2020 |
Napsáno | C#, C ++, C ++ / CLI |
Operační systém | Windows 7 SP1 nebo později[1] |
Plošina | .NET Framework[1] |
Velikost | 9,2 MB |
K dispozici v | 25 jazyků |
Seznam jazyků Angličtina, čínština (zjednodušená), čínština (tradiční), čeština, dánština, holandština, finština, francouzština, němčina, hindština, maďarština, italština, japonština, korejština, litevština, norština, perština, polština, portugalština (Brazílie), portugalština (Portugalsko) ), Ruština, španělština, turečtina, ukrajinština[1] | |
Typ | Rastrový grafický editor |
Licence | Freeware[2] |
webová stránka | getpaint |
Paint.net (stylizované jako Paint.NET nebo paint.net) je freeware editor rastrových grafik program pro Microsoft Windows, vyvinutý na .NET Framework. Paint.net byl původně vytvořen Rickem Brewsterem jako Washingtonská státní univerzita studentský projekt,[3] a vyvinul se z jednoduché náhrady za Microsoft Paint program do programu pro editaci hlavně grafiky, s podporou pro pluginy.
Dějiny
Paint.net vznikl jako počítačová věda senior design design během jara 2004 v Washingtonská státní univerzita. Verze 1.0 sestávala z 36 000 řádků kódu a byla napsána za patnáct týdnů.[4] Naproti tomu verze 3.35 má přibližně 162 000 řádků kódu. Projekt paint.net pokračoval přes léto a do podzimního semestru 2004 u verzí 1.1 a 2.0.
Vývoj pokračuje s jedním programátorem, který pracoval na předchozích verzích Paint.net, když byl studentem na WSU. V květnu 2006 byl program stažen nejméně 2 milionykrát,[5] tempem kolem 180 000 za měsíc.[6]
Paint.net byl původně vydán pod upravenou verzí Licence MIT, s výjimkou instalačního programu, textu a grafiky.[7] Bylo to úplně open-source, ale protože došlo k porušení licence, byly všechny soubory prostředků (například text rozhraní a ikony) uvolněny pod nesvobodnou licencí Licence Creative Commons zakazující úpravy a instalační program se stal uzavřeným zdrojem.[8] Verze 3.36 byla původně vydána jako částečný open-source, ale Brewster později zdrojový kód odstranil s odvoláním na problémy s plagiátorstvím. Ve verzi 3.5 se stal paint.net proprietární software. Uživatelé mají nyní zakázáno jej upravovat.[8][9]
Počínaje verzí 4.0.18 je paint.net vydáván ve dvou vydáních: Zůstává klasické vydání freeware, podobně jako všechny ostatní verze od 3.5. Další vydání je však vydáno pro Microsoft Store pod zkušební verze licenci a lze ji zakoupit za 7 USD. Podle vývojáře to bylo provedeno s cílem umožnit uživatelům přispívat k vývoji s větší pohodlností, přestože stará cesta dárcovství nebyla uzavřena.[10][11]
Přehled
Paint.net je primárně programován v C # programovací jazyk. Jeho nativní formát obrázku, .PDN, je stlačený reprezentace interní aplikace objekt formát, který zachovává vrstvení a další informace.[12]
Pluginy
Paint.net podporuje pluginy, které přidávají úpravy obrazu, efekty a podporu pro další typy souborů. Lze je programovat pomocí libovolného .NET Framework programovací jazyk, i když jsou nejčastěji psány C#.[13] Ty jsou vytvářeny kodéry dobrovolníků na diskusním fóru programu paint.net Forum. Ačkoli většina z nich je jednoduše publikována prostřednictvím diskusního fóra, některé byly zahrnuty do pozdějšího vydání programu. Například a DirectDraw Surface do Paint.net ve verzi 3.10 byl přidán plugin typu souboru (původně Dean Ashton) a efekt Ink Sketch and Soften Portrait (původně David Issel).
Byly vyrobeny stovky pluginů;[14] například Shape3D, který vykreslí 2D výkres do 3D tvaru. Některé doplňky rozšiřují funkce, které jsou součástí Paint.net, například Curves + a Sharpen +, které rozšiřují obsažené nástroje Curves a Sharpen.
Mezi příklady typů souborů patří pluginy Animovaný kurzor a ikona plugin a Plugin formátu Adobe Photoshop.[14] Některé z těchto pluginů jsou založeny na existujícím open source softwaru, například a surový formát obrázku plugin, který používá dcraw a optimalizační plugin PNG, který používá OptiPNG.
Vidlice
barva mono
Paint.net byl vytvořen pro Windows a nemá nativní podporu pro žádný jiný systém. Díky své předchozí povaze open-source byla k dispozici možnost alternativních verzí. V květnu 2007 Miguel de Icaza oficiálně zahájil a portování projekt s názvem barva mono.[15] Tento projekt částečně přenesl Paint.net 3.0 na Mono, open-source implementace Společná jazyková infrastruktura na kterém je .NET Framework založen. To umožnilo provozovat Paint.net na platformách podporovaných Mono, jako je Linux. Tento port již není udržován a nebyl aktualizován od března 2009.[15]
Pinta
V roce 2010 zahájil vývojář Jonathan Pobst projekt s názvem Pinta, popisující to jako klon Paint.net pro Mono a GTK #. Pinta znovu použil kód úprav a efektů z Paint.net, ale jinak je původní kód.[16]
Zprávy
Verze | Datum vydání | Významné změny |
---|---|---|
1.0 | 6. května 2004 | První vydání. |
1.1 | 1. října 2004 | Podpora efektových pluginů. |
2.0 | 17. prosince 2004 | Mnoho nových efektů, úprav a nástrojů. |
2.5 | 26. listopadu 2005 | Podpora internacionalizace; správce aktualizací; podpora pluginů typu souboru. |
2.6 | 24. února 2006 | Použití .NET Framework 2.0, plná 64bitová podpora. |
2.72 | 31. srpna 2006 | Poslední verze k podpoře Windows 2000. |
3.0 | 26. ledna 2007 | Toto hlavní vydání představuje nové rozhraní pro více dokumentů (MDI), dostupnost v 8 jazycích, vysoce požadovaný interaktivní nástroj pro přechody, čtyři nové efekty, uživatelem definovatelnou paletu barev, nižší využití místa na disku pro stírací soubory a obecně čistší a vylepšené uživatelské rozhraní |
3.05 | 29. března 2007 | Přidán nový efekt; vylepšené určité části uživatelského rozhraní. |
3.10 | 23. srpna 2007 | Přidány efekty Ink Sketch a Soften Portrait; podpora typu souboru DDS. |
3.20 | 12. prosince 2007 | Vylepšení vestavěných efektů, přeorganizovaná nabídka Efekty, nový a mnohem jednodušší systém pro vývoj efektových pluginů, lepší zpracování chyb pro pluginy a schopnost kreslit výběry Fixed Ratio a Fixed Size pomocí nástroje Rectangle Select. (S touto verzí již Paint.NET již není otevřeným zdrojem a ze serverů jsou odebrány dokonce i zdroje verze 3.10). |
3.22 | 12. ledna 2008 | Přidá nový efekt Reduce Noise. |
3.30 | 10. dubna 2008 | Toto vydání přidává italský překlad, nový efekt „Fragment Blur“ a možnost ukládání PNG obrázky v 8bitové a 24bitové barevné hloubce. Pro vývojáře má systém IndirectUI několik nových ovládacích prvků, některá nová pravidla omezení a lze jej nyní použít pro doplňky typu souboru. |
3.35 | 7. června 2008 | Nová úprava Posterize, nový režim výběru Průnik, dramaticky zlepšil výkon při úpravách výběru. |
3.5 | 6. listopadu 2009 | Vylepšená spolehlivost výkonu, snížení využití paměti, upgrade na nejnovější verzi rozhraní .NET Framework a obnovení uživatelského rozhraní pro Aero a glass (Windows 7 / Vista) |
3.5.2 | 4. ledna 2010 | Řeší některé disparity funkcí v textovém nástroji mezi GDI (Windows XP) a DirectWrite (Windows 7 / Windows Vista). Zlepšuje také celkový výkon, správnost a kvalitu nástroje Přesunout vybrané pixely, funkce Image-> Resize a nastavení Odstín / Sytost. |
3.5.5 | 26.dubna 2010 | Opravuje chybu při ukládání 8bitových obrázků, zlepšuje složení vrstev a výkon Gaussian Blur a je aktualizován, aby v některých případech podporoval nový .NET Framework 4.0. Zrušená podpora systému Windows XP bez aktualizace Service Pack 3, další podpora pro .NET 4.0.[17] |
3.5.11 | 17. srpna 2013 | Opravuje efekt Gaussian Blur, který nesprávně počítal hodnoty alfa pro neprůhledné pixely. Efekty Sharpen, Median, Fragment a Unfocus zaznamenaly vylepšený výkon o 25%, 30%, 40% a 100%. Také využití paměti je sníženo, když je mnoho operací manipulace s výběrem v zásobníku historie / zpět. Integrovaný aktualizátor nyní podporuje upgrade na paint.net 4.0 |
4.0 | 24. června 2014 | 4.0 vyžaduje Windows 7 SP1 nebo novější (včetně 8 / 8.1, ale kromě XP a Vista) a používá .NET Framework 4.5.1 (lze jej v případě potřeby nainstalovat automaticky)[18] Toto kompletní přepsání obsahuje zcela nový, asynchronní, plně vícevláknový vykreslovací modul, vyhlazené výběry, přepracované uživatelské rozhraní, měkké stopy a nový nástroj pro tvary. Většina nástrojů nyní podporuje „jemně zrnitou historii“ a může upravit vlastnosti toho, co uživatel nakreslil před potvrzením vrstvy.[19] |
4.0.6 | 2. srpna 2015 | Aktualizováno pro Windows 10. Zvyšuje maximální velikost stopy na 2000. Nástroj pro tvary nyní umožňuje instalaci a používání vlastních tvarů. Efektové doplňky založené na IndirectUI nyní mohou poskytovat text nápovědy, přístupný pomocí tlačítka otazníku. |
4.0.7 | 30. prosince 2015 | Aktualizováno pro .NET Framework 4.6. Přidán švédský překlad. Záhlaví používá barvu zvýraznění Windows 10. Vlastní tvary XAML nyní podporuje kardinální splajny prostřednictvím PolyCurveSegment. Tvaruje výkon vykreslování nástroje na procesorech s mnoha jádry.[20] |
4.0.10 | 8. července 2016 | Do editoru byl přidán „overscroll“. |
4.0.20 | 9. ledna 2018 | Aktualizováno pro .NET Framework 4.7.1. Přidána podpora Dark Theme. |
4.1 | 5. září 2018 | Několik efektů přepsáno pro použití GPU. Zkopírujte a vložte výběry. Dva nové efekty: Morfologie a Turbulence. Zvýšena maximální úroveň přiblížení na 6400%. Vylepšení IndirectUI. |
4.2 | 13. července 2019 | Přidané HEIF podpora formátů souborů, stálý výkon u velmi velkých obrázků a inovace a modernizace funkcí mnoha existujících typů souborů |
4.2.1 | 7. srpna 2019 | Přidané JPEG XR podpora formátu souborů |
4.2.2 | 18. září 2019 | Lze otevřít AVIF soubory (ale neuložené), vylepšeno DirectDraw Surface podpora a 4bitové ukládání pro PNG / BMP / TIFF |
4.2.5 | 1. října 2019 | Přidané WebP podpora formátu souborů |
4.2.6 | 21. listopadu 2019 | Přidáno nastavení „Nativní vstup ukazatele“, pokud je k dispozici zařízení „ukazatel“.[21] |
4.2.7 | 25. listopadu 2019 | Opravena chyba při spuštění (FileLoadException) kvůli 1) útržku souboru System.Runtime.dll, který nebyl aktualizován, a 2) zásadě pevné verze vázání, která bránila starší verzi pracovat místo ní (což by bylo v pořádku tento případ).[22] |
4.2.8 | 3. prosince 2019 | Tato malá aktualizace opravuje několik naléhavých chyb, zejména při zadávání dotykem a perem.[23] |
4.2.9 | 31. ledna 2020 | Tato aktualizace výrazně zlepšila výkon a výrazně snížila využití paměti, přidala dva nové překlady a opravila řadu drobných problémů.[24] |
4.2.10 | 14. února 2020 | Opraveny některé důležité chyby, zejména u instalací, které k nasazení přímo používají soubor MSI.[25] |
4.2.11 | 20. května 2020 | Přidává podporu metadat XMP, 3 nové překlady, některá vylepšení uživatelského rozhraní a několik oprav chyb.[26] |
Viz také
- Úpravy obrázků
- Porovnání editorů rastrové grafiky
- Seznam editorů rastrové grafiky
- Seznam svobodného softwaru
Reference
- ^ A b C Brewster, Ricku. "paint.net Stáhnout". dotPDN, LLC. Citováno 13. ledna 2018.
- ^ Brewster, Rick (6. listopadu 2009). „Nová licence pro Paint.NET v3.5“. blog paint.net. dotPDN LLC. Citováno 2011-05-01.
- ^ "paint.net - bezplatný software pro úpravy digitálních fotografií". Citováno 30. září 2009. Dolní část stránky níže o.
- ^ „Paint.NET v1.1“ Beta 2 „Stáhnout“. Archivovány od originál dne 21.12.2007.
- ^ „Paint.NET překračuje 2 miliony stažení a další novinky“. Archivovány od originál 2. ledna 2008. Citováno 16. června 2006.
- ^ Mook, Nate (27. února 2006). „Interview: A Look Inside Paint.NET“. Betanews. Betanews, Inc. Archivovány od originál 30. října 2011. Citováno 16. června 2006.
- ^ paint.net - Licencování a FAQ
- ^ A b „Freeware Autoři: Pozor na“ Backspaceware"". blog paint.net. 4. prosince 2007. Citováno 2017-07-27.
- ^ „Nová licence pro Paint.NET v3.5“. Citováno 2015-02-11.
- ^ Rubino, Daniel (30. září 2017). „Paint.NET je nyní k dispozici v obchodě Windows pro všechny počítače se systémem Windows 10“. Windows Central. Mobilní národy.
- ^ Brinkmann, Martin (1. října 2017). „Paint.net přistává v obchodě Windows (ale není zdarma)“. blázni.
- ^ "Formát souboru Paint.NET," .pdn"". Archivovány od originál dne 2008-01-02.
- ^ "CodeLab: Paint.NET Plugin Development Environment". 16. srpna 2014.
- ^ A b „Rejstřík pluginů“.
- ^ A b Projekt Malovat Mono na Google Code
- ^ Holwerda, Thom (8. února 2010). „Představujeme Pintu, klon Gtk + Paint.NET“. OSNews. Citováno 2014-09-25.
- ^ Brewster, Ricku. „Paint.NET v3.5.5 je nyní k dispozici“. blog paint.net. dotPDN, LLC. Citováno 26. dubna 2010.
- ^ Paint.NET - Stáhnout: Požadavky na systém
- ^ „paint.net 4.0 je nyní k dispozici!“. 24. června 2014.
- ^ „paint.net 4.0.7 je nyní k dispozici“. 30. prosince 2015. Citováno 7. února 2016.
- ^ „paint.net 4.2.6 je nyní k dispozici“. 21. listopadu 2019. Citováno 23. listopadu 2019.
- ^ „paint.net 4.2.7 je nyní k dispozici“. 25. listopadu 2019. Citováno 26. listopadu 2019.
- ^ „paint.net 4.2.8 je nyní k dispozici“. 3. prosince 2019. Citováno 4. prosince 2019.
- ^ „paint.net 4.2.9 je nyní k dispozici“. 31. ledna 2020. Citováno 1. února 2020.
- ^ „paint.net 4.2.10 je nyní k dispozici“. 14. února 2020. Citováno 15. února 2020.
- ^ „paint.net 4.2.11 je nyní k dispozici“. 20. května 2020. Citováno 20. května 2020.
Další čtení
- „Rick Brewster na Paint.NET“ (MP3 ). .NET Rocks!. Franklins.net/PWOP Productions Inc. 17. dubna 2007. Citováno 15. března 2011.
- "Barva barvy a barevná kombinace". eWeek DevSource. Saboor Aziz. 25. prosince 2019. Citováno 25. prosince 2019.[trvalý mrtvý odkaz ]
- Sells, Chris (12. srpna 2005). „MSDN TV: Paint.NET - .NET Framework v akci“. Microsoft Download Center. společnost Microsoft. Citováno 15. března 2011.
Chris Sells rozhovory s Rickem Brewsterem, Tomem Jacksonem a Craigem Taylorem o jejich projektu Paint.NET v2.1.
- „Jak nainstalovat doplňky Paint.NET“. BoltBait Dot Com. 2007. Citováno 15. března 2011.
externí odkazy
- Oficiální webové stránky
- fórum paint.net
- openpdn na Google Code - vidlice paint.net 3.36.7
- barva mono na Google Code - neoficiální snaha přenést paint.net 3.0 na Linux pomocí Mono